In a major step, the government has assigned ministers, state ministers and parliamentary whips to oversee and coordinate overall government activities across all 64 districts, with a particular focus on law and order, corruption control, drug trafficking, good governance, transparency, accountability, and the proper implementation of development and public welfare programmes.
Cabinet Division on Thursday issued a gazette notification in this regard in implementing a Cabinet decision of the government formed following 13th Jatiya Sangsad (JS) election.
According to the notification, the government has expressed deep concerns over widespread corruption and alleged looting of development funds during the previous “fascist regime.” It said that while development allocations were shown on paper, large amounts were allegedly embezzled, with part of the money reportedly laundered abroad and another portion allegedly used for offensive activities�"including drug-related operations�"that pose threats to social stability, public safety and the national security.
The government said it is collectively accountable to the running JS and the people of Bangladesh for development, corruption control, law and order, good governance and national security. Ensuring sustainable development, transparency, accountability and the elimination of corruption has been identified as a priority.
Now, the notification cited Article 55(2) of the Constitution and the Rules of Business, stating that the Prime Minister may exercise executive authority and permit necessary deviations from the Rules where requires. It also referred to a High Court judgment in Writ Petition No. 3512 of 2003, under which such distribution of responsibilities falls within the government's authority, without curtailing the legal powers of local government entities, or other constitutional and statutory bodies.
Under the new allocation, Iqbal Hasan Mahmud has been assigned Rajshahi and Natore; Abu Jafar Md Zahid Hossain�"Lalmonirhat, Nilphamari and Panchagarh; Abdul Awal Mintoo�"Lakshmipur; Nitai Roy Chowdhury�"Chuadanga; and Khondkar Abdul Muktadir�"Habiganj.
Ariful Haque Chowdhury will oversee Moulvibazar; Md Shahid Uddin Chowdhury Annie�"Chattogram; M Rashiduzzaman Millat�"Sherpur, Mymensingh and Netrakona; Asadul Habib Dulu�"Thakurgaon and Dinajpur; and Md Asaduzzaman�"Khulna, Satkhira and Bagerhat.
Zakaria Taher has been assigned Feni and Noakhali; Sardar Sakhawat Hossain Bakul�"Manikganj and Munshiganj; Saching Pru�"Cox’s Bazar; Md Shariful Alam�"Tangail and Narsingdi; Shama Obaed Islam�"Madaripur and Shariatpur; Anindya Islam Amit�"Meherpur, Kushtia and Jhenaidah; Abdul Bari�"Bogura and Chapainawabganj; and Sultan Salauddin�"Dhaka district.
